Why Does Apple ID Get Locked? Apple takes security seriously, and to protect users, it locks accounts for several reasons, including: Entering the wrong password multiple times Security breaches or suspicious activity Attempting to access an account from an unknown device or location Failing verification processes If you find yourself locked out, don’t worry. You can recover your account even if you don’t have access to your email or phone number. 1. Use iforgot.apple.com/unlock One of the easiest and most official ways to unlock your Apple ID is through iforgot.apple.com/unlock. Here’s how: Steps to Unlock Apple ID: Go to iforgot.apple.com/unlock using any browser. Enter your Apple ID (email address associated with your Apple account). Click Continue and follow the on-screen prompts. If you don’t have access to your email or phone number, select “Don’t have access to these?” Answer security questions or choose other available verification methods. Follow the steps to reset your password and regain access to your Apple ID. If you don’t remember security answers or can’t use the suggested options, try the next methods. 2. Reset Your Apple ID with Trusted Devices If you previously signed in to your Apple ID on another device, such as an iPhone, iPad, or Mac, you can reset your Apple ID from that device. Steps to Reset Apple ID on a Trusted Device: On your iPhone or iPad: Go to Settings > Tap [Your Name] > Select Password & Security. Tap Change Password and follow the prompts. On a Mac: Click on Apple Menu > System Preferences > Apple ID. Choose Password & Security > Change Password. Follow the instructions to reset your password and regain access. 3. Contact Apple Support for Account Recovery If you can’t reset your Apple ID via iforgot.apple.com/unlock or a trusted device, contacting Apple Support is your next best option. Steps to Contact Apple Support: Visit Apple Support Click Apple ID > Forgot Apple ID Password. Select Talk to Apple Support Now. Provide details, answer security questions, and follow Apple’s instructions. Apple may initiate an account recovery process, which could take several days. 4. Use a Recovery Key (If Enabled) Apple introduced a Recovery Key feature to help users regain access to their accounts. Steps to Use a Recovery Key: Go to iforgot.apple.com/unlock and enter your Apple ID. When prompted, enter your Recovery Key (a 28-character code provided when you set up two-factor authentication). Follow the instructions to reset your Apple ID password and unlock your account. If you don’t have your Recovery Key, you will need to follow Apple’s account recovery process. 5. Reset Apple ID via iTunes or Finder For those who can’t access their Apple ID via other methods, resetting via iTunes or Finder can be a last resort. Steps to Reset Apple ID via iTunes/Finder: Put your iPhone in Recovery Mode: For iPhone 8 and later: Press Volume Up, then Volume Down, then hold the Side button until you see the recovery screen. For iPhone 7/7 Plus: Hold the Volume Down and Power button until you see the recovery screen. For iPhone 6S and earlier: Hold the Home and Power button until you see the recovery screen. Connect your iPhone to a Computer Open iTunes (on Windows or older macOS) or Finder (on macOS Catalina and later). Select “Restore” or “Update” Choose Restore to erase the device and remove the Apple ID. Follow the on-screen instructions to set up your iPhone. 6. Visit an Apple Store If none of the above methods work, you can visit an Apple Store or an Apple Authorized Service Provider. Bring your device and proof of purchase for verification. Steps to Get Help at an Apple Store: Make a Genius Bar appointment via Apple’s Support website. Provide necessary documents (ID, proof of purchase). Explain the issue to an Apple expert. Follow Apple’s instructions to unlock your Apple ID. Tips to Avoid Apple ID Lockouts in the Future To prevent getting locked out of your Apple ID, follow these best practices: Keep your recovery email and phone number updated. Set up Trusted Contacts to help with account recovery. Enable Two-Factor Authentication for added security. Save your Recovery Key if you use it. Use a password manager to store credentials securely. What is iforgot.apple.com? iforgot.apple.com is Apple’s official platform designed to help users recover their Apple ID credentials. Whether you’ve forgotten your password, need to unlock your account, or manage other Apple ID-related issues, this site provides a straightforward solution. How to Access iforgot.apple.com on Your Mobile Device Follow these simple steps to access and use iforgot.apple.com on your smartphone or tablet: Step 1: Open Your Mobile Browser Unlock your mobile device and open your preferred web browser (e.g., Safari, Chrome, or Firefox). In the address bar, type iforgot.apple.com and press Enter. You’ll be redirected to the official iForgot page. Step 2: Enter Your Apple ID On the main page, you’ll see a prompt asking you to enter your Apple ID (email address associated with your account). Type in your Apple ID and tap the arrow icon to proceed. Step 3: Verify Your Identity To protect your account, Apple requires identity verification. Depending on your account settings, you may be prompted to: Answer Security Questions: Provide answers to the questions you set up during account creation. Receive a Verification Code: Apple will send a code to your registered email or phone number. Use Two-Factor Authentication: Approve the recovery request on a trusted device or enter the verification code sent to your device. Step 4: Reset Your Password After successful verification, you’ll be given the option to reset your password. Create a strong, unique password that meets Apple’s requirements. Confirm the new password and save the changes. Step 5: Log Back In Use your new password to log in to your Apple ID. Ensure all devices linked to your Apple ID are updated with the new credentials. Tips for a Seamless Recovery Process 1. Ensure a Stable Internet Connection Make sure your mobile device is connected to a reliable Wi-Fi or cellular network. A weak connection may cause delays or interruptions during the recovery process. 2. Keep Your Trusted Devices Handy If you have two-factor authentication enabled, ensure your trusted devices are nearby to receive verification codes or approve recovery requests. 3. Update Your Browser Using the latest version of your web browser ensures compatibility with Apple’s iForgot website and enhances security. 4. Double-Check Your Apple ID Before initiating the recovery process, confirm that you’re entering the correct Apple ID. Mistyped email addresses can lead to unnecessary delays. 5. Use Strong Passwords When resetting your password, choose a combination of let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id using easily guessable information such as birthdays or common words. Common Issues and Troubleshooting Tips 1. Forgotten Apple ID Email Address If you can’t remember your Apple ID email address, try the following: Search your email inbox for Apple-related communications (e.g., receipts or account notifications). Check your iPhone or iPad settings under “[Your Name] > Apple ID” to find the associated email address. 2. Locked Account If your account is locked due to multiple failed login attempts: Visit iforgot.apple.com and follow the steps to unlock your account. Ensure you’re using the correct credentials to prevent further issues. 3. No Access to Trusted Devices or Email If you don’t have access to your trusted devices or email: Use the “Didn’t receive a code?” option on the verification screen. Select an alternative method to verify your identity, such as answering security questions. Contact Apple Support for additional assistance. 4. Browser Compatibility Issues If you’re experiencing issues with the website: Clear your browser’s cache and cookies. Switch to a different browser or device.
